
Hall of Fame quarterback and current Seattle Seahawks broadcaster Warren Moon was arrested for suspicion of DUI:
A Medina police officer spotted Moon's vehicle on the Highway 520 Bridge at about 2:10 a.m. Friday and noticed it had expired tabs, said Medina police Lt. Dan Yourkoski.
Moon had a valid Texas driver's license, but his driving privileges have been revoked in Washington, Yourkoski said.
Moon, 51, was arrested and taken to a Kirkland police station, where he was processed and released, Yourkoski said. A report will be sent to the King County Prosecutor's Office for possible charges, he said.
This isn't the first time Moon has had some trouble driving this year. In August, Moon pleaded guilty to negligent driving that was tied to a DUI arrest (he was found to be under the legal limit).
Moon is the first African-American QB inducted in the Hall of Fame. He played for the Houston Oilers, Minnesota Vikings, Seattle Seahawks and Kansas City Chiefs in his 17-year NFL career.
